Matlab函数基础结构与高性能编写指南
摘要:
本篇文章介绍了Matlab函数基础结构,详细解释了如何构建和使用各种函数,还提供了高性能函数编写的实用指南,帮助读者优化代码,提高函数运行效率,通过学习和实践,读者将能够掌握Matlab函数的核心知识,并能够编写出高效、可靠的函数。
Matlab函数的基本结构包括函数名称、输入参数、输出参数、函数体以及结束语句,编写高性能函数的关键在于遵循良好的编程习惯,如避免不必要的计算、使用向量化操作、利用Matlab内置函数和避免全局变量等,应注意函数的模块化设计,将复杂问题分解为多个简单函数,提高代码的可读性和可维护性,优化算法和数据类型选择也是提高函数性能的重要方面。
老铁们,大家好!相信有很多朋友对MATLAB函数的基本结构、如何编写高性能函数以及MATLAB函数大全及例子等方面存在疑问,我来为大家分享这方面的知识。
文章目录:
- MATLAB如何定义函数
- 用MATLAB编写函数
- 编写一个函数文件求两个数的最大值
- 编写其他功能的函数...
- 如何用MATLAB编写函数程序
- MATLAB函数编写的问题
我们详细讨论以上内容。
MATLAB如何定义函数?
在MATLAB中定义函数的关键是明确其表达式并划分各个区间,确定函数的x取值范围,例如0到3,对于y值的计算,需要为每个区间定义特定的函数表达式,这些表达式会乘以x在该区间内的逻辑值,确保按照区间进行计算。
如何定义呢?在MATLAB中创建一个新的.m文件,使用任何文本编辑器创建此文件,或在MATLAB的命令窗口中直接创建,在这个.m文件中,你可以定义一个函数,函数的定义以function开始,后面紧跟着函数的输出变量和输入变量。
用MATLAB编写函数
编写一个函数文件求两个数的最大值:
打开MATLAB,点击“主页”下的“新建”按钮,选择“function”选项,在函数编辑器中设置函数的输入,并编写代码来求两个数的最大值,保存编辑好的功能文件。
编写其他功能的函数:
同样地,在MATLAB中创建新的.m文件,并定义其他功能的函数,根据需要编写具体的函数实现,并保存文件。
如何用MATLAB编写函数程序?
除了单独编写函数文件,你还可以将多个函数组合成一个函数程序,在MATLAB中创建新的.m文件,然后在该文件中定义多个函数,每个函数都有明确的输入和输出变量,以实现特定的功能。
MATLAB函数编写的问题:
在编写MATLAB函数时,可能会遇到一些问题,例如公式指数、对数的使用不当,或者无法正确识别end等,确保函数的逻辑正确,并根据需要调整参数和变量。
希望以上内容能够帮助到大家,如有更多疑问或需要进一步的解释,请随时提问,我们一起探讨MATLAB函数的更多细节和高级用法!